Delivery Date Time & Pickup for WooCommerce Vulnerability History & Security Timeline

The Wordfence Intelligence dataset currently contains 4 vulnerability records associated with Delivery Date Time & Pickup for WooCommerce, published between 2023 and 2026.

Affected-Version History

Ranges are deduplicated by source range record and shown with the associated disclosure and known patched versions.

Affected rangeVulnerabilityPublishedPatched versionSeverity
*-2.5.5WooODT Lite <= 2.5.5 - Unauthenticated Payment BypassFebruary 11, 20262.5.6Medium
*-2.5.1WooODT Lite – Delivery & pickup date time location for WooCommerce <= 2.5.1 - Unauthenticated Full Path DsiclosureFebruary 17, 20252.5.2Medium
*-2.4.6WooODT Lite <= 2.4.6 - Missing Authorization to Arbitrary Options UpdateOctober 31, 20232.4.7High
*-2.4.6WooODT Lite <= 2.4.6 - Reflected Cross-Site ScriptingOctober 3, 20232.4.7Medium

Running an affected version does not prove that a website was compromised. Suspicious redirects, unknown administrators, injected content, unexpected files or recurring malware may require a manual investigation.
